Understanding the Difference Between Baby Teeth and Permanent Teeth
Baby teeth (also called primary teeth) usually appear whiter, smaller, and shinier. Permanent teeth, however, often look more yellow in comparison.
Why?
Enamel Thickness: Baby teeth have thinner enamel that reflects more light, making them appear whiter. Permanent teeth have thicker enamel, but the underlying dentin layer is yellowish, which makes them look darker.

Size of Teeth: Permanent teeth are larger, which makes the yellowish shade more noticeable next to remaining white baby teeth.
Natural Color Variation: Just like eye or skin color, the natural shade of teeth varies from child to child.
Is It Normal for Permanent Teeth to Look Yellow?
Yes! In most cases, yellowish permanent teeth are completely normal and not a sign of poor dental hygiene. Parents should not panic, as this is simply how nature designed permanent teeth.
However, sometimes yellow teeth could be linked to:
Plaque or tartar buildup if brushing is not proper.
Early enamel defects such as fluorosis or hypomineralization.
Staining from food, drinks, or medications.
Preventive Care: Keeping Your Child’s Teeth Healthy
Even if the natural color difference is normal, good oral hygiene ensures your child’s permanent teeth stay healthy and stain-free. At AMD Dental Clinic, Jaipur, our pediatric dentist near you recommends these preventive steps:
1. Proper Brushing Habits
Use a pea-sized amount of fluoride toothpaste twice daily.
Teach your child to brush all tooth surfaces for at least 2 minutes.

2. Regular Dental Check-ups
Schedule visits to a children’s dental clinic in Jaipur every 6 months. A pediatric dentist can professionally clean teeth, remove plaque, and detect early enamel problems.
3. Balanced Diet for Strong Teeth
Limit sticky sweets and sodas. Include calcium-rich foods like milk, yogurt, cheese, and leafy greens to strengthen enamel.
4. Preventive Dental Treatments
Fluoride application to strengthen enamel.
Sealants on molars to prevent cavities.

Early orthodontic assessment if teeth erupt crowded.
When Should You Be Concerned?
Book an appointment with a kids dentist in Jaipur if you notice:
Brown, chalky, or white spots on the teeth.
Teeth that break or chip easily.
Severe yellowing that looks uneven or patchy.
Persistent tooth pain or sensitivity.
